Description
Cheesy pizza pockets are golden, flaky pastries stuffed with gooey melted cheese, pizza sauce, and your favorite toppings—perfect for a quick snack or party treat.
Ingredients
- 1 package (14 oz) refrigerated pizza dough
- 1/2 cup pizza sauce
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up sliced pepperoni (optional)
- 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 egg, beaten (for egg wash)
- 1 tablespoon olive oil (optional, for brushing)
- Flour, for dusting
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- On a lightly floured surface, roll out the pizza dough into a large rectangle about 1/4 inch thick.
- Cut the dough into 6 equal rectangles (or circles if preferred).
- Spoon about 1 tablespoon of pizza sauce into the center of each piece of dough.
- Top with mozzarella, Parmesan, and a few slices of pepperoni if using.
- Fold the dough over to form a pocket and seal the edges by pressing with a fork.
- Brush each pocket with the beaten egg and sprinkle with garlic powder and oregano.
- Place the pockets on the baking sheet and bake for 15–18 minutes or until golden brown.
- Brush lightly with olive oil for shine (optional) and let cool for 5 minutes before serving.
Notes
- Use any fillings you like—veggies, sausage, or cooked chicken all work well.
- These can be frozen after baking and reheated in an oven or air fryer.
- Serve with marinara sauce or ranch dressing for dipping.
